Fairplay, Colorado
Take your Rocky Mountain getaway to new heights with a trip to this Fairplay home, situated 3 miles from the heart of town and 20 miles from Breckenridge! The 3-bedroom, 2.5-bath vacation rental offers a rustic atmosphere filled with modern comforts and amenities, including a full kitchen, stocked game room, and private mountain-view deck. After your day on the hiking trails, ski slopes, or mountain biking treks, soak in the private hot tub or host a cookout on the grill!
